In the last couple of months some jobs started taking a lot of time and often timing out due to slow `apt install` from the Azure Ubuntu mirror. The jobs affected were those that installed large packages: GHA/http3-linux and the 3 cross-build jobs in GHA/windows. This patch reduces the installed packaged to the minimum required to complete the jobs. Saving a minute+ for each http3-linux job (a total of 20+ minutes for the workflow.) Also saving bandwidth and reducing the chance for long downloads or timeouts with slow Azure repos. Details: - http3: delete redundant packages from the `build-cache` job. - http3: install gnutls dependencies for gnutls jobs only. - http3: do not install test dependencies in jobs not running tests. - http3: drop redundant packages from the curl jobs. - Windows-cross: replace `mingw-w64` with `gcc-mingw-w64-x86-64-win32` for the 3 Windows cross-build job. Dropping C++, 32-bit, and 64-bit POSIX-threaded parts. Saving time and significant bandwidth for each of the 3 jobs: Download size: 277 MB -> 65 MB (installed: 1300 MB -> 400 MB) - Windows-cross: restore previous job time limit of 15m (from 45m) Follow-up to |

curl is a command-line tool for transferring data specified with URL syntax. Learn how to use curl by reading the manpage or everything curl.
Find out how to install curl by reading the INSTALL document.
libcurl is the library curl is using to do its job. It is readily available to be used by your software. Read the libcurl manpage to learn how.
Open Source
curl is Open Source and is distributed under an MIT-like license.
